1994 /1996 strut
i got a 1994 grand am gse..i needed a strut but didnt want to sink a lot of money into the car..so i went to the junkyard and found a good one for $12.00...but it is out of a 1996 grand am...will it work...what if i install it..what problems will i face

Re: 1994 /1996 strut
struts are cheap, get a new one. But that strut wouldnt work anyways, the suspenion is different from 95-98 then 94 and i even think that there is a difference between the 92-93 and the 94. So your best bet is to go buy a new one, might be like 30 bucks.

Re: 1994 /1996 strut
If you can find a Hollander exchange manual, it will advise on whether the years are compatible.
I would go with 97's thinking though, the strut itself isn't very costly, and if you just swapped out of a similar year ride, you still have a used strut that likely will fail shortly also. |
